The accuracy of the results can vary based on the quality of the questions and the user's honesty in responding. While the app can provide useful insights, it should not be considered a definitive assessment of one's personality. Results are best used as a guide for self-reflection rather than as an absolute measure of narcissism.
The test typically consists of a series of statements or questions that users rate based on their personal experiences and feelings. After completing the assessment, users receive feedback on their results, which may include insights into their narcissistic tendencies and suggestions for improvement or reflection. The app may also provide resources for further reading and understanding of narcissism.
